Jump Rope for Heart is a fantastic physical activity and fundraising program that has been run by the Heart Foundation for over 36 years. It’s a great way for your child to keep fit and learn new skills, but it also helps raise funds for vital heart research and education programs.

Camps, Sports and Excursions Fund (CSEF) - The CSEF helps eligible families to cover the costs of school trips, camps and sporting activities.  If you have a valid concession card you may be eligible.  Payment this year is $125.00 per student and payments are made directly to the school and credited to your account to go toward camps, excursions for the benefit of your child.  If you applied for CSEF at our school last year, you do not need to complete an application form this year, unless there has been a change in your family circumstances.  If you would like to apply, please contact Andrea at the office for an application form.
